US commission on religious freedom fails to obtain visas to India

Author : NewsGram Desk

New Delhi (dpa) – India has delayed visas to representatives of a US agency that rates countries' levels of religious freedom, preventing a planned visit, the group said Friday. "We are deeply disappointed by the Indian government's denial, in effect, of these visas," said Robert P George, chairman of the US Commission on International Religious Freedom…
